We didn't like Level C as much as we liked Level B and at times we had to put this book aside. It was a little slow and tedious at some points and we had to liven math up a bit. That being said however, there are some concepts that I just can't teach the way Joan Cotter does. I am not math minded and the concepts and tricks that she presents would never occur to me naturally nor would I be able to teach them without her scripts. Some things I can present on my own and we can explore other ways but many of her strategies are very helpful for my children so I will continue to use RightStart for these valuable lessons. We may just pick and choose lessons or skim through the next level but there are some concepts that I know I will need the Lessons book to teach.
